P(-3)=x^3+5; evaluate P(-3)

You are given P(x) = x^3 + 5, not P(-3). You are to evaluate the function at x=-3.
The function is
P(x)=x^3+5. Let's now replace x with (-3):
P(-3) = (-3)^3 + 5 = -27 + 5 = -22 (answer)
